Corporate Real Estate & Workplace Intern - Summer 2026

NXP Semiconductors is a fast-paced global semiconductor leader seeking an intern to support real estate strategy, sustainability, and workplace experience initiatives. The role involves working on projects that impact global offices and labs, focusing on employee experience, financial performance, and ESG goals.

Responsibilities

Enhance employee experience through workspace design and hybrid work programs. Assist in space planning and workplace design projects
Participate in global site strategy projects including consolidation, expansion or new projects
Support ESG data tracking and reporting aligned with green building and sustainability standards (energy usage, waste reduction,..) Assist in evaluating current projects against LEED certification requirements
Assist in gathering energy usage and waste reduction. Relaying data to internal ESG team
Support to analyze projected costs for lease renewal or site relocation options. Assist in reviewing property information (availability and cost) provided by real estate brokers
Engage in defining existing property operational costs
Coordinate with internal teams to align real estate initiatives with operational goals
Help manage transitions during workplace changes through planning and communication. Assist in answering general questions about workplace changes using information provided by internal and external teams
Engaging in workplace experience discussions with external professionals
Analyze occupancy trends, site utilization, and facility performance Engage in review and analysis of occupancy and site utilization data
Assist in analysis of Work from Office trends against industry standards
Help prepare presentations, dashboards and reports for senior leadership and key stakeholders

Qualification

Data AnalyticsSustainabilityReal Estate Financial ModelingExcelPower BICommunication SkillsPowerPointACADBuilding Codes KnowledgeProblem-Solving SkillsOrganizational Skills

Required

Pursuing a Bachelor's or Master's degree in real estate, Architecture, Urban Planning, Construction, Sustainability or related field
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
High-level understanding of building related project scheduling
Proficiency in Excel, ACAD, PowerPoint; familiarity with building codes (IBC) and data tools (Power BI, Tableau) is a plus
Interest in sustainability and workplace innovation
Excellent communication and organizational skills
